在Web开发中,JSP(JavaServer Pages)技术因其强大的功能和灵活的扩展性,被广泛应用于各种项目中。而在JSP页面中,定时器是一个非常有用的功能,它可以定时执行一些操作,如更新数据、发送通知等。本文将为大家介绍JSP页面上的定时器实例,帮助大家实现动态更新与交互体验。

一、定时器的基本原理

JSP页面上的定时器实例实现动态更新与交互体验  第1张

定时器在JSP页面中主要通过JavaScript实现。JavaScript是一种轻量级的编程语言,具有跨平台、跨浏览器的特点。在JSP页面中,我们可以通过JavaScript的`setTimeout`和`setInterval`函数来实现定时器功能。

1. `setTimeout`函数:该函数用于设置一个定时器,当定时器到达指定时间后,执行指定的函数。函数格式如下:

```javascript

setTimeout(functionName, time);

```

其中,`functionName`表示要执行的函数名,`time`表示定时器时间,单位为毫秒。

2. `setInterval`函数:该函数用于设置一个周期性定时器,每隔指定时间执行一次指定的函数。函数格式如下:

```javascript

setInterval(functionName, time);

```

与`setTimeout`类似,`functionName`表示要执行的函数名,`time`表示定时器时间。

二、JSP页面上的定时器实例

下面将通过几个实例来展示如何在JSP页面中使用定时器。

1. 实例一:定时更新时间

这个实例中,我们将使用`setInterval`函数每隔一秒更新页面上的时间。

```html

定时更新时间